A great excursion in a breathtaking gorge. It was quite a hot day, but very shady and cool in the gorge. We drove with our rental car to a small church, but the last part we preferred to walk to the car park and the entrance to the gorge, because the road was a bit too adventurous for our taste. Our KIA would probably not have been able to cope. We hiked up the gorge for about 50 minutes, had a picnic and then hiked back the same way. If you’re lucky you spot wild goats and the red dragonfly. Better wear good shoes and take water and snacks with you - there is a taverna nearby but it is another walk away. Recommend, recommend!

We never did a hike like this before. But “you haven’t seen Cyprus if you did not do this trail” so we wanted to try it. The road towards the parking area already is a challenge. Many holes and bumps in the road. Some very steep hills. Challenging to drive. We decided to walk the last part to the parking. We parked the car at the sign of the restaurant. The last part just was too steep for my taste. The trail itself is gorgeous! You do need good shoes because you have to climb many rocks. But the views are beautiful! We did not do the entire trail. Halfway we turned around and went back. On the way back everything looks different so it did not feel that we walked the same path twice. Recommended !!! Amazing nature experience! Better use hiking shoes and stick. Kids can visit with many cautions. Best time to go is early morning since there is little people and no hot sun. Overall it is a great way to spend your morning-midday. Google maps show an off road way for some meters. And you need to walk the downhill in order to find the gorge's entrance. Better use the Lara beach road.

Turtle Beach, here the turtles arrive in July and August. The females lay their eggs in a hole 50 cm deep. These are very soft eggs that will not break when laid. The little turtles go to the sea after 7 weeks, a unique natural phenomenon. The turtles already know how to get to the sea when they leave the egg, a nice place to visit
